Transaction 34c3914ed77e9108c132be45e281a2a6024880bc2ba3c7c895b451ceb49441aa

1 Input
1 Outputs
  • 34c3914ed77e9108c132be45e281a2a6024880bc2ba3c7c895b451ceb49441aa:0
  • value  2783582
    address  3NaRkcVQZzBFZ1K6PhM7y9LpcXXSTVtEDu